How to tint a 57 Chevy without removing the glass
Method: Cut your film and then shrink it on the outside. Don’t ever use a torch on this model as the glass will break fairly easily. Cut a 1/16th inch gap on the bottom edge of the rear glass and a hairline gap around the whole thing to prevent the film from sucking up debris. The curvy corners on the bottom of the rear glass usually require some extra time and slack. Let the car sit in the sun to dry before your final touch up.
